A Step-by-Step Guide to Updates
To keep your Android device up-to-date, a simple trip to the Settings app is all it takes. Navigate to 'Google services' and explore the 'All services' tab to access the latest system updates. However, it's important to note that not all features listed in the changelog are immediately available to all users. Some rollouts can take months, creating a gradual evolution of the Android experience.
Account Management and Developer Services
The latest Google Play services update introduces Quick Start, a feature that simplifies the setup process for new devices using an existing Android device. Additionally, developers now have access to new tools to integrate Maps-related processes into their apps. With beta features enabled through Cross Devices Services, the possibilities for app development are expanding.
Enhancing Device Connectivity and Location Services
Android's August update brings exciting improvements to device connectivity. With Tap to Share, users can now easily share contact information, photos, and more by simply tapping phones together. This feature, along with other gesture-based sharing options, enhances the convenience of Android devices.
For Wear OS users, Google Location Sharing offers a centralized way to manage location-sharing settings for supported Google apps. This update ensures a more seamless and secure experience when sharing your location.
Wallet and Play Store Enhancements
The Wallet app now supports push provisioning for age credentials, adding a layer of convenience and security to age-restricted transactions. Meanwhile, the Google Play Store update introduces a new navigation bar, allowing users to explore their interests directly on the home pages.

Discoverability and Search Enhancements
The Google Play Store update brings several improvements to discoverability and search functionality. Users can now explore popular movies and TV shows directly in their search results, making it easier to find the content they're looking for. Additionally, the new sports feature introduces league-specific carousels, allowing users to stay updated on major events and connect with dedicated streaming providers.
